    Yao's defensive strengths are all about blocking or changing shots in the paint. If he gets pulled outside he can be beaten off the dribble, as with Carlos Boozer last year in the playoffs. The Rockets really need to find some way to mitigate this problem--send help to cute off the lane or something.

    So what's killed the Rockets against good teams recently?

    1) Stagnant offense/scoring droughts.
    2) Turnovers.
    3) Inability to get defensive rebounds.

    The Rockets are good for a couple of quarters of good passing and movement without the ball. Then they regress under pressure to standing around and trying to force the ball into Yao. Will there be any improvement against Orlando?
